Garlic Butter Steak with Cajun Pasta

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Course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 4 servings
Calories 700 kcal

Ingredients
  

For the Steak

  • 1.5 lb sirloin steak, cut into 1-inch cubes Tender and juicy, perfect for searing.
  • 1 teaspoon kosher salt Enhances the natural flavors of the meat.
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per Adds a subtle heat and depth.
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der For that essential garlicky essence.
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ika Infuses a lovely smoky flavor.
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il A rich oil for searing.
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ter Adds a luscious creaminess.
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ced Use plenty for rich flavor.

For the Pasta

  • 12 oz rotini or fusilli pasta Twists and curls that hold onto the creamy sauce.
  • 1 cup heavy cream Creates a silky texture.
  • 1-2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ning, to taste For a spicy kick that elevates the dish.
  • 0.5 teaspoon garlic powder A second whisper of garlic.
  • 0.5 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ese Rich, cheesy finish.
  • 0.25 teaspoon red pepper flakes, optional For extra spice.
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ley Brightens the dish.

Instructions
 

Cooking the Pasta

  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. Cook the rotini or fusilli until al dente according to package directions. Reserve 1/2 cup of the pasta water, then drain the rest.

Preparing the Steak

  • Pat the steak cubes dry with paper towels. Season the steak with kosher sal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and smoked paprika, tossing until evenly coated.
  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the steak in a single layer. Sear for 2-3 minutes total, turning to brown all sides. Remove the steak to a plate.

Making the Sauce

  • Reduce heat to medium, add unsalted butter to the skillet, and let it melt. Stir in minced garlic, cooking for 30-60 seconds until fragrant.
  • Pour in heavy cream, scraping up the browned bits. Stir in Cajun seasoning, garlic powder, and red pepper flakes. Let it simmer for 3-4 minutes, then stir in Parmesan cheese until smooth.

Combining Everything

  • Add drained pasta to the skillet and toss to coat in the sauce. Gradually add reserved pasta water, stirring until the sauce is glossy. Fold in the seared steak and juices, warming for an additional minute.
  • Garnish with fresh parsley and extra Parmesan before serving.

Notes

For best results, pat the steak dry before seasoning, reserve pasta water to adjust sauce consistency, and avoid overcooking the garlic.
